| 正面描述 | Central vignette presents a Galápagos giant tortoise (Chelonoidis niger) in naturalistic detail, set against a stylized cartographic underprint of the Galápagos Islands archipelago. The denomination '1000 SUCRES' appears in bold lettering alongside the scientific name 'Chelonoidis niger' and the inscription 'GALÁPAGOS TORTOISE'. The overall design employs a warm earth-tone palette consistent with a commemorative collector issue. |

| 背面描述 | The reverse bears a detailed vignette of Darwin's Arch, the celebrated natural rock formation located southeast of Darwin Island in the Galápagos archipelago, rendered in a scenic engraving style. A portrait of the naturalist Charles Darwin (1809–1882) appears alongside the arch motif, with the denomination '1000 SUCRES' repeated in bold type. A disclaimer legend running across the lower register explicitly identifies the note as a non-legal-tender collector's item. |
